The Journal of Folklore Research Reviews is approaching its third
birthday, to be celebrated in January of 2009. Staffed by editor John
McDowell, associate editor William Hansen, and editorial assistant
Steve Stanzak, our mission is to publish quality reviews of scholarly
works that should be of interest to folklorists, and to distribute
these reviews swiftly by sending them directly to the electronic
mailboxes of our subscribers. All reviews are permanently stored on
the Journal of Folklore Research website at
http://www.indiana.edu/~jofr/. To date we have published reviews of
books and CDs, but we are open to expanding this coverage to other
media and venues of scholarly production.
